We all know the importance of eating LESS & moving MORE. I mean that’s how you lose weight, right?? About five years ago I lost 35 pounds and it took me a solid year and a half. Clearly I believe in the ‘slow and steady’ approach. Since then, I’ve focused on maintaining a healthy weight and I must say, I totally enjoy the process. 

These days I’m obsessed with nourishing my body. Whether that means eating a delicious  meal of healthy nourishing REAL foods, or waking up early and heading to the gym, taking time to nourish myself and to practice self love doesn’t just mean I eat LESS and move MORE.  I also make sure to prioritize sleep, spend quality time with those I love, treat myself to daily dark chocolate, and take time to reflect on life in my journal. 

When it comes to taking care of my body, I know how important it is to ‘fuel up’. I never skimp on nutrition. One of my favorite ways to nourish? EAT REAL FOOD. I make sure to enjoy a balance of carbohydrates for quick energy, protein to keep me full, and healthy fat to keep me satisfied.
